The cities of Irpin and Bucha, became symbols of resilience during russia's full-scale invasion of Ukraine in February 2022. The residents came out to defend their cities, formed territorial defense units, and stopped the advance on Kyiv, but at the cost of enormous losses and suffering. These cities experienced some of the most horrific days of the war, when ordinary people found themselves under constant shelling, without electricity, communications, and food, forced to fight for survival in wartime conditions.

Ukraine is a vast and diverse country in Eastern Europe, known for its rich history, vibrant culture, and stunning landscapes. From the bustling streets of Kyiv to the tranquil Carpathian Mountains, Ukraine offers a unique blend of ancient traditions and modern innovations, making it a captivating destination for travelers.
A historic Orthodox Christian monastery and UNESCO World Heritage Site, Kyiv Pechersk Lavra is a complex of churches, caves, and museums.
The historic center of Lviv is a UNESCO World Heritage Site, known for its well-preserved medieval architecture, vibrant squares, and lively atmosphere.
The Chernobyl Exclusion Zone is a restricted area around the site of the Chernobyl nuclear disaster. Guided tours offer a unique and sobering look at the aftermath of the disaster.
